10.  Using the Selection tool, click the second rectangle on the artboard and drag until
                   a guide line appears, connecting the center points of the first and second shapes.

                   As you drag, the cursor feedback shows the relative position of the object. In other
                   words, you can see the change (difference) in the object’s position, both horizontally
                   (X) and vertically (Y) — hence the “dX” and “dY” values.

                   As we explained previously, Smart Guides can be very useful for aligning objects on the
                   artboard. Illustrator identifies and highlights relative alignment as you drag, and snaps
                   objects to those alignment points.

               11.  Release the mouse button while the center Smart Guide is visible.
                   If you don’t see the alignment guides as you drag, make sure that option is checked in
                   the Smart Guides preferences.

               12.  Click the fourth shape on the page. In the Control or Transform panel, select
                   the top-right reference point, type 8.25 in the X field, and type .25 in the Y field.
                   Because you changed the reference point, you defined the X/Y position for the top-right
                   bounding box handle of the fourth rectangle.
